Mepherdrone

Introduction to Mepherdrone

Mepherdrone, often referred to as "meow meow" or 4-MMC, is a synthetic stimulant belonging to the cathinone class. Its discovery can be traced back to the early 2000s, and since then, it has gained popularity in various circles for both medical and recreational purposes.

Chemical Composition

Mepherdrone's chemical structure is similar to amphetamines, impacting the central nervous system. The compound stimulates the release of neurotransmitters, such as dopamine and serotonin, resulting in heightened mood and increased energy levels.

Mechanism of Action

Understanding how Mepherdrone affects the brain is crucial. It primarily works by increasing the levels of dopamine in the synaptic cleft, leading to intense feelings of euphoria and pleasure. This mechanism is similar to other stimulants but has unique characteristics due to its cathinone nature.

Recreational Use and Risks

The surge in Mepherdrone's popularity as a recreational substance has raised concerns regarding its potential risks. Users may experience adverse effects like increased heart rate, anxiety, and even psychosis. Long-term use can lead to addiction and severe mental health issues.
